


PLANTATION KEY -- The young man who had sex with a 16-year-old girl in a home-made porn movie must register as a sexual offender and serve five years' probation after pleading "no contest" in circuit court Monday.
Derek Williams, 19, was filmed last March while having sex with the girl at a Key Largo apartment while eight other teens egged them on.
Two other teens, also over 18, were previously sentenced to two years of probation, but were not designated sexual offenders.
The difference, according to Assistant State Attorney Colleen Dunne, arose when Williams also tried to encourage a 14-year-old girl to engage in sexual activity while the camera recorded his advances.
The court withheld adjudication on two other counts related to the porn production, thereby sparing him from becoming a convicted felon.
Williams was also charged with two other counts, including contributing to the delinquency of a minor, but those charges were dropped in exchange for his plea.
Williams will serve up to five years' probation, 180 days in county jail (with credit for whatever time served since his arrest in March) and must pay court costs as well as the cost of investigation and prosecution.
He was also ordered to obtain a psycho-sexual evaluation followed any recommended treatment.
Williams is also to have no contact with any of the codefendants, be subjected to random urinalysis and was ordered not to possess any pornographic images, videos or literature.
